#311201 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#311201 is composed of 19.2% red, 7.1%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 63.3% magenta, 98% yellow and 80.8% black. It has a hue angle of 21.3 degrees, a saturation of 96% and a lightness of 9.8%. #311201 color hex could be obtained by blending #622402 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330000.

● #311201 color description : Very dark (mostly black) orange [Brown tone].
#311201 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#311201 has RGB values of R:49, G:18,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.63, Y:0.98, K:0.81. Its decimal value is 3215873.

Shades and Tints of #311201
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0400 is the darkest color, while #fff9f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#311201
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#1a1918 is the less saturated color, while #311201 is the most saturated one.
